chore: graph view, dns-zone gap, fleet deploy/cleanup tooling
Graph view: raise the node cap 500 -> 2000 and exclude execution/task audit rows from the default whole-graph view so the cap is spent on actual topology rather than ~380 cognition records that crowded out every host/lxc/service. dns-zone monitoring [dns] -> none: no dns checker exists, so the declaration only produced unresolvable `unmonitored` noise (requires ontology re-ingest; coverageSweep now auto-clears the stale signals). Flip back to [dns] when a checker lands. Operator tooling: tools/deploy-checks.sh pushes check scripts into guests via pct push (a pct-exec-routed check runs the script INSIDE the guest), wired into the post-pull setup-checks hook so guests stay in sync on Proxmox hosts; scripts/cleanup-orphan-checks.sh (dry-run by default) and report-stray-test-lxcs.sh retire legacy cruft. VERSION 0.13.0 -> 0.14.0. Plan: plans/2026-07-29-health-check-reality-and-knowledge-graph.md.
